What are the responsibilities and job description for the Staff Auditor position at BREC Recreation And Park Commission for the Parish...?
JOB
The Staff Auditor assists with evaluating organization efficiency and effectiveness; work involves examining, investigating, and reviewing records, reports, financial statements, and management practices; assessing compliance with legal and administrative requirements; and reviewing the adequacy of internal financial and management controls. Work performed is of a complex nature.
EXAMPLE OF DUTIES
Education: Bachelor's degree and Graduation from an accredited 4-year college or university in the area of Accounting, Finance or closely related field of study required. License: Valid LA Driver's LicenseYears Relevant Work Experience: 2 years related accounting experience. Equivalent combination of education and experience will be considered. 10 or more years related experience, preferred.Other Job Specifications: Understanding of internal controls and testing of controls. Experience with Sarbanes Oxley testing is a plus.Knowledge of data processing systems and journal entry preparationEnsure compliance with all applicable plans, polices and standardsUnderstanding of Governmental Accounting Standards Board (GASB) and/or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P)Skill in the use of a computer, 10-key calculatorStrong interpersonal skills, critical thinking skills, and time management skillsTeam-oriented with a strong sense of ownership and accountabilitySolid analytical skills with a thoughtful and open-minded approach to problem solvingProficient in MS Office applicationsHighly motivated with the ability to multi-task and remain organized in a fast-paced environmentAbility to exercise good judgment and discretion with sensitive or confidential issues and/or personal matters.Proficient verbal and written communication skillsAbility to quickly learn BREC policies and proceduresAbility to establish and maintain effective working relationships with other employees and the public
